Jeff McWhorter is a skilled SolidWorks Draftsman currently working at Impact Selector International since December 2019 to convert old Inventor drawings into SolidWorks models and load files into the SolidWorks PDM Vault. With extensive experience as a 3D Designer/Draftsman since July 2019, McWhorter demonstrates proficiency in SolidWorks, AutoCAD, and Inventor, primarily serving the offshore oil and gas/pipeline industry. Previous roles include positions at EPIC Companies, LLC as a CAD Drafter, Ranger Offshore, Inc. as a Design & Drafting Consultant, and a Senior Designer at Technip Umbilicals Inc. McWhorter's professional background also includes supervisory experience at Cal Dive International and project design at Forum Oilfield Technologies. Educational credentials include coursework at Lee College, Brazosport College, MLC Cad, and Total CAD Systems.
